What Does HYD Mean in Text?
HYD in text usually stands for “How You Doing?”
It is a casual way to ask someone how they are feeling, what they are doing, or how life is going.
People often use HYD in:
- Text messages
- Snapchat chats
- Instagram DMs
- WhatsApp conversations
- Gaming chats
- Online communities
The tone of HYD is usually:
- Friendly
- Casual
- Relaxed
- Caring
- Informal
It is not normally rude or offensive.
When someone sends “HYD,” they are usually trying to start a conversation or check in with you.

HYD vs Similar Texting Terms

Many texting abbreviations have similar meanings.
Here is a simple comparison table.
| Texting Term | Meaning | Common Usage |
| HYD | How You Doing? | Casual check-in |
| WYD | What You Doing? | Asking current activity |
| HRU | How Are You? | Friendly greeting |
| SUP | What’s up? | Casual opener |
| HBU | How About You? | Asking back |
| NM | Not Much | Casual reply |
| WSG | What’s good? | Slang greeting |
HYD vs WYD
This is one of the biggest misunderstandings.
HYD
Means:
“How are you doing emotionally or generally?”
WYD
Means:
“What are you doing right now?”
The two abbreviations are similar but not identical.

HYD With Emojis
Emojis can change tone.
Examples:
- “HYD 😊” = warm and friendly
- “HYD ❤️” = affectionate
- “HYD lol” = playful
- “HYD?” = neutral
Tone matters a lot in texting.
